• DSP using Matlab 示例Example2.2


    a、

    n = -2:10; x = [1:7,6:-1:1];                % generate x(n)
    [x11,n11] = sigshift(x,n,5); [x12,n12] = sigshift(x,n,-4);
    [x1,n1] = sigadd(2 * x11, n11, -3 * x12, n12);
    
    set(gcf,'Color',[1,1,1])                  % 改变坐标外围背景颜色
    stem(n,x); title('Sequence x(n)')
    xlabel('n');ylabel('x(n)');
    grid on
    
    figure                                    % 新生成一张图
    set(gcf,'Color',[1,1,1])                  % 改变坐标外围背景颜色
    stem(n1,x1); title('Sequence in Example 2.2a')
    xlabel('n'); ylabel('x1(n)');
    grid on
    

    b、

    n = -2:10; x = [1:7,6:-1:1];                % generate x(n)
    [x21,n21] = sigfold(x,n);    [x21,n21] = sigshift(x21,n21,3);
    [x22,n22] = sigshift(x,n,2); [x22,n22] = sigmult(x,n,x22,n22);
    [x2,n2] = sigadd(x21, n21, x22, n22);
    
    % subplot(2,1,1);
    set(gcf,'Color',[1,1,1])                  % 改变坐标外围背景颜色
    stem(n,x); title('Sequence x(n)')
    xlabel('n');ylabel('x(n)');
    grid on;
    
    figure 
    set(gcf,'Color','white')                                   % 新生成一张图
    stem(n2,x2); title('Sequence in Example 2.2b')
    xlabel('n'); ylabel('x2(n)');grid on;
    

      

    不足之处,欢迎批评指正。

      

    牢记: 1、如果你决定做某事,那就动手去做;不要受任何人、任何事的干扰。2、这个世界并不完美,但依然值得我们去为之奋斗。
  • 相关阅读:
    OC
    OC
    核心动画
    核心动画
    核心动画
    数据存储1
    plsql语句基础
    Oracle3连接&子查询&联合查询&分析函数
    oracle2约束添加&表复制&拼接
    Oracle表空间创建及表创建
  • 原文地址:https://www.cnblogs.com/ky027wh-sx/p/6006379.html
Copyright © 2020-2023  润新知